Finding Safety: Your Guide to Emergency Shelters
When disaster strikes, it's crucial to have a plan in place. Knowing where to go for safety can be instrumental. Emergency shelters provide temporary housing and support during crises like natural disasters or human-caused emergencies. These centers offer a safe haven with access to food, water, and medical care, helping you weather the storm until things are safer.
- Ahead of an emergency, research shelters in your area. Familiarize yourself with their rules and evacuation routes.
- If a disaster, stay informed for instructions on where to go.
- Bear in thought that shelters can be busy, so be equipped with essential items like medication, a first-aid kit, and comfortable clothing.
